  • Located in London's Drury Lane; near the capital's best theatre offerings, Takari is a fun, fresh spot at which to enjoy tradtional Indian cuisine in attractive surroundings. Close to Covent Garden and Holborn tube stops, Takari is the perfect pre-show stop off. Totally dedicated to customer service, the staff at Takari ensure that from the moment you walk through that door your dinner is a real occasion. From the comfortable surroundings to the lavish food the attention to detail is clear. Each dish is beautifully spiced and cooked to perfection using traditional Indian methods. What's more, the restaurant is completely halal friendly.
